Convertigo Introduces Open Source Version of Integration Platform For Mashups and Mobile Development



Paris, and San Francisco – November 30th, 2011 – Convertigo announced the first open source edition of its core software integration platform. Now, within minutes and at no charge, developers can join the Convertigo Community and start using one of the industry’s most powerful integration tool sets to solve enterprise integration problems for legacy, portal and mobile applications.

eXo and Convertigo Accelerate Portal Development with Dynamic Widget Wiring


eXo customers can now ‘widgetize’ existing applications and wire them together for use in the eXo Platform, increasing developer productivity by up to 90 percent


Convertigo to commit widget wiring technology to GateIn portal project, co-led by eXo and Red Hat




SAN FRANCISCO, California – April 12, 2011 – eXo, a provider of Java portal and user experience technologies, and Convertigo, maker of server technology to create composite applications and mashups, today announced a partnership to accelerate user-centric development with widgets and gadgets on eXo Platform. As part of this agreement, Convertigo will also be contributing its widget wiring technology to the GateIn project.

Carrefour Builds Innovative Mobile Commerce Application Leveraging Existing Assets in Seven Weeks With Convertigo


Company mixes difficult-to-access business applications and data, serves up a new shopping experience for customers

Paris, France and San Francisco, California – March, 2011 -- Carrefour’s IT ecommerce department chose the Convertigo Mashup Server, which enabled the IT team to utilize innovative integration technology to deploy a mission-critical mobile shopping app in seven weeks in order to be the very first to launch a continuous experience between the smartphone and the existing web site.
